Sat 691944183090565

decimal
138388.4183090565
degree
0°138388′1300″4183090565‴
percentile
32.94972304055733%
name
iyhqwhilywa
cycle
0
epoch
0
period
68
block
138388
offset
4183090565
timestamp
rarity
common